        <![CDATA[<p>A nursing home in Canton, Ohio has lost its federal funding for having too many violations.  According to inspectors, each time they went to the facility there was another problem.  Unlike large corporate facilities, many smaller homes survive on Medicare and Medicaid to supplement what individual residents can pay to live in the home.  This facility had a troubling list of violations including a patient not getting blood thinning medication until five days after the doctor prescribed it, a resident reported an instance of <a href="http://www.levinperconti.com/lawyer-attorney-1119726.html"target="new">patient on patient rape</a> and the doctor was not notified until 11 hours afterwards, a patient had severely matted and soiled hair resulting from his hair <a href="http://www.levinperconti.com/lawyer-attorney-1088032.html"target="new">only being washed two or three times in six months at the facility</a>, and old, <a href="http://www.levinperconti.com/lawyer-attorney-1088032.html"target="new">used syringes lying around in patient rooms</a>.  </p>

        <![CDATA[<p>The National Citizen’s Coalition for Nursing Home Reform (NCCNHR), in conjunction with the SEIU, has set up a toll free hotline to get people in touch with their Senators about the importance of S. 2641, the Nursing Home Transparency and Improvement Act of 2008.  To call, dial 1-866-544-7573. After a brief message about the bill, you will be asked to press "1" to be connected to a Capitol operator. Ask for your senator's office. (Senators are listed in order by State on the Senate website, if you need to find their names.) According to NCCHNR, When the senator's office answers, identify yourself and say:</p>

<p>"Please ask Senator ______ to co-sponsor S. 2641, the Nursing Home Transparency and Improvement Act. The bill is sponsored by Senators Grassley and Kohl. Nursing home residents and their families in Illinois are strongly supporting this bill."</p>

<p>The Act would improve publicly available resources and information about nursing homes, increase transparency of Medicare and Medicaid spending in nursing homes, shed light on nursing home ownership, and improve the consumer complaint process.         <![CDATA[<p><a href="http://www.levinperconti.com"target="new">Levin & Perconti</a> have filed a <a href="http://www.levinperconti.com/lawyer-attorney-1088032.html"target="new">nursing home abuse and neglect lawsuit</a> against Summit Assisted Living Naperville North for the <a href="http://www.levinperconti.com/lawyer-attorney-1088032.html"target="new">wrongful death of an 87-year old woman</a> under the Illinois Assisted Living Act.  The woman entered the Summit Assisted Living center in 2005 with a condition called Meniere’s disease which disrupts a person’s normal balance in the inner ear, making her more susceptible than a normal resident to <a href="http://www.levinperconti.com/lawyer-attorney-1119720.html"target="new">falls and losing her balance</a>.  However, the assisted living facility did not accommodate for her disorder and she fell 7 times in a 5 month period, leading to a <a href="http://www.levinperconti.com/lawyer-attorney-1088032.html"target="new">fractured hip, multiple lacerations, and injuries to her right knee and back</a>.  This is an <a href="http://www.levinperconti.com/lawyer-attorney-1088032.html"target="new">assisted living wrongful death action</a> because the woman’s injuries – <a href="http://www.levinperconti.com/lawyer-attorney-1119720.html"target="new">her fractured hip, damaged knee, lacerations and back injuries</a> – precipitated her death.<br />

        <![CDATA[<p>A recent article highlights the dangers of residing in and placing family members in uninsured nursing homes.  Uninsured nursing homes are extremely dangerous for residents because there is no way that residents can get fair and reasonable compensation for their injuries and families can recoup fair and reasonable compensation for their loved one’s wrongful death in a <a href="http://www.levinperconti.com/lawyer-attorney-1088032.html"target="new">nursing home abuse and neglect lawsuit</a>.  The article highlights three tragic cases where a woman suffered <a href="http://www.levinperconti.com/lawyer-attorney-1088032.html"target="new">severe pressure sores</a> because nurses did not maintain her cast, another woman suffered when she was <a href="http://www.levinperconti.com/lawyer-attorney-1088032.html"target="new">left on a bedpan for too long</a>, and one resident <a href="http://www.levinperconti.com/lawyer-attorney-1088032.html"target="new"> died from dehydration in a nursing home</a>.  Unfortunately, none of these residents nor their families could <a href="http://www.levinperconti.com/lawyer-attorney-1088032.html"target="new">fair and reasonable compensation</a> for their injuries.  Currently, the Illinois House is considering HB 5213 which would require at least $1 million in insurance coverage for Illinois nursing homes to protect residents who may be victims of <a href="http://www.levinperconti.com/lawyer-attorney-1088032.html"target="new">nursing home abuse and neglect</a>.</p>

        <![CDATA[<p>The Centers Medicare and Medicaid Services Nursing Home Compare website has added a new section that allows viewers to see information on nursing homes and identify homes that have drawn increased federal scrutiny for complaints and other forms of <a href="http://www.levinperconti.com/lawyer-attorney-1088032.html"target="new">nursing home abuse and neglect</a>.  The website includes a listing of Special Focus Facilities which are nursing homes that receive increased federal inspection as a result of past poor performance.  Notably, five Illinois nursing homes made the list.  Embassy Health Care Center in Wilmington, IL and Harrisburg Care Center of Harrisburg, IL are both on the “not improved” list.  Facilities that have shown improvement include Alden Park Strathmoor in Rockford, Berkshire Nursing & Rehab in Forest Park, and International Village in Chicago.</p>

        <![CDATA[<p>Proposed changes to federal funding for Medicaid could cost Illinois more than 10,000 jobs and over $400 million in lost wages.  Over the next five years, Illinois could see upwards of $2.5 billion in lost funding.  Critics of the federal plan warn that reductions in Medicaid funding will shift the bill to the state in an already shaky economy.  For <a href="http://www.levinperconti.com/lawyer-attorney-1088032.html"target="new">Illinois nursing homes</a><br />
 this reduction in Medicaid is a serious threat to resident care and could lead to increased incidents of <a href="http://www.levinperconti.com/lawyer-attorney-1088032.html"target="new">nursing home abuse and neglect</a>.  For instance, a nursing home in Peoria illustrates the problem: more than 70% of its residents are Medicaid funded.  Many nursing homes and their residents that count on Medicaid may have to make alternative arrangements if the budget cuts go through.  </p>
